Job Description
- Understanding, quantifying, budgeting and managing the costs of the works involved in the Project (during the design and construction stages)
- Review construction plans and preparing quantity requirements
- Scrutinize maintenance and material costs, as well as contracts to ensure the best deals
- Review and approve the monthly statement applications (or other documents) issued by the subcontractors, and advise on the contractual claims
- Track any changes to the design or actual work and document any changes in design
- Liaise with project engineers, site managers, subcontractors, the Client and its Consultants (if needed)
- Prepare reports, analyses, risk assessment and other documents which may be required by the Project Director for the Client or other relevant stakeholders
- Manage his/her team and report to the Contract Manager and the Project Director
